## Deployment

Snapshot tests for Glimmerkit UI components run automatically before each deploy. If a snapshot diff blocks a release, support can ask the owning squad to approve or regenerate baselines — never skip the gate manually. The test runner in staging uses the configuration values shown below.

settings of bawif-fawif:
ralix:
  log_level: warn
  metrics_host: metrics.ralix.tolvaqsys.internal
  pool_size: 32

Ticket: PICK-2287 — Optimizer emits duplicate bin visits on split orders

The Rookline pick-list optimizer occasionally schedules the same bin twice when an order is split across waves. Root cause: the dedupe pass runs before wave merging, so merged routes reintroduce visited bins. Fix is to move dedupe after merge in `route_finalize`. Added a regression case with a three-wave split. Future maintainers: reproduce only on the build referenced below.

session token of yajof-bagef = htk4_937d

Tomas — handover on the Ridgeway depot uniforms. All 48 sets arrived from Stellan Workwear, sorted by size on rack C. Two jackets came mislabelled; I've flagged them and a replacement pair ships next week. The rest are boxed for transfer, manifest taped to box 1. Courier pickup is booked for Friday morning. Meet the driver at dock 4 yourself — the confidential hand-over instruction follows below.

handover note for yagef-bagep: the drudor pelius courier leaves the kasdor zorvan norir ledger at gate 8016 under passcode 755406